Легенда:
новое сообщение
закрытая нитка
новое сообщение
в закрытой нитке
старое сообщение
|
- Напоминаю, что масса вопросов по функционированию форума снимается после прочтения его описания.
- Новичкам также крайне полезно ознакомиться с данным документом.
| |
Да, действительно помогло, спасибо.
25.01.04 08:35 Число просмотров: 2136
Автор: Argentum[BugTraq.ru] Статус: Незарегистрированный пользователь
|
> После установки numcpu = 2 > (в dnetc.ini запись > [proccesor-usage] > max-threads=2)
Да, действительно помогло, спасибо.
Сервак действительно не мой, просто я знаю к нему пароль ;)
Буду пускать иногда по ночам, когда дежурю...
|
<dnet>
|
[RC5] Комп-тормоз? 19.01.04 01:06
Автор: Argentum[BugTraq.ru] Статус: Незарегистрированный пользователь
|
Попробовал запустить ключегрызку на хорошем компе - 4х2800MHz XEON.
(попутно вставляю логи клиента)
---
Automatic processor detection found 4 processors.
Automatic processor type detection found an Intel Xeon processor.
---
Запускаю бенчмарку :
---
RC5-72: Benchmark for core #0 (SES 1-pipe) 0.00:00:17.15 [2,186,726 keys/sec]
RC5-72: Benchmark for core #1 (SES 2-pipe) 0.00:00:16.95 [2,948,660 keys/sec]
RC5-72: Benchmark for core #2 (DG 2-pipe) 0.00:00:16.73 [2,495,250 keys/sec]
RC5-72: Benchmark for core #3 (DG 3-pipe) 0.00:00:17.71 [3,226,458 keys/sec]
RC5-72: Benchmark for core #4 (DG 3-pipe alt) 0.00:00:17.64 [2,593,038 keys/sec]
RC5-72: Benchmark for core #5 (SS 2-pipe) 0.00:00:16.43 [2,535,628 keys/sec]
---
Вобщем близко к истине, хотя и меньше того, что я нашел в базе процов (там была цифра 3,935,299).
Запускаю счет,
---
4 crunchers ('a'-'d') have been started.
---
через некоторое время торможу, чтоб поглядеть как там скорость. И что же я вижу?
---
RC5-72: Saved CA:79DDCA7A:00000000:1*2^32 (47.80% done)
0.00:02:27.10 - [994,461 keys/s]
RC5-72: Saved CA:79DDCA79:00000000:1*2^32 (49.30% done)
0.00:02:27.10 - [987,778 keys/s]
RC5-72: Saved CA:79DDCA65:00000000:1*2^32 (49.70% done)
0.00:02:27.10 - [942,777 keys/s]
RC5-72: Saved CA:79DDCA64:00000000:1*2^32 (47.80% done)
0.00:02:27.10 - [949,015 keys/s]
---
И это действительно так, эти жалкие 4 пакета считались 1час 14минут.
Там, конечно, есть еще процессы на этой тачке, но клиент берет 90-100% под себя. Откуда же такая низкая скорость???
Да, ядро он выбирает автоматом и вроде бы правильное - 3-е. Операционка вин2000 адв. сервер.
|
|
Вот одно из решений проблемы (доб) 22.01.04 11:13
Автор: Garick <Yuriy> Статус: Elderman Отредактировано 23.01.04 10:39 Количество правок: 2
|
Конфигурация 2*Xeon -2.4/533/512 HT enable
Win2K Srv SP4 "чистая" установка + терминал сервер (подключений клиентов не было)
Бенчмарк
Automatic processor type detection found an Intel Xeon processor.
RC5-72: Benchmark for core #0 (SES 1-pipe) 0.00:00:17.17 [1,886,178 keys/sec]
RC5-72: Benchmark for core #1 (SES 2-pipe) 0.00:00:16.95 [3,200,711 keys/sec]
RC5-72: Benchmark for core #2 (DG 2-pipe) 0.00:00:17.31 [2,205,547 keys/sec]
RC5-72: Benchmark for core #3 (DG 3-pipe) 0.00:00:17.43 [3,408,239 keys/sec]
RC5-72: Benchmark for core #4 (DG 3-pipe alt) 0.00:00:16.56 [2,821,825 keys/sec]
RC5-72: Benchmark for core #5 (SS 2-pipe) 0.00:00:16.39 [2,281,960 keys/sec]
при дефолтных настройках
RC5-72: using core #3 (DG 3-pipe).
4 crunchers ('a'-'d') have been started.
RC5-72: Completed CA:795C9066:00000000 (1.00 stats units) 0.01:27:44.90 - [815,785 keys/s]
RC5-72: Summary: 1 packet (1.00 stats units) 0.01:27:44.90 - [815,785 keys/s]
RC5-72: Completed CA:795C9065:00000000 (1.00 stats units) 0.01:27:54.29 - [814,332 keys/s]
RC5-72: Summary: 2 packets (2.00 stats units) 0.01:27:56.75 - [1,627,908 keys/s]
RC5-72: Completed CA:795C9064:00000000 (1.00 stats units) 0.01:28:21.79 - [810,108 keys/s]
RC5-72: Summary: 3 packets (3.00 stats units) 0.01:28:23.92 - [2,429,352 keys/s]
RC5-72: Completed CA:795C9063:00000000 (1.00 stats units) 0.01:28:25.93 - [809,476 keys/s]
RC5-72: Summary: 4 packets (4.00 stats units) 0.01:28:28.01 - [3,236,638 keys/s]
После установки numcpu = 2
(в dnetc.ini запись
[proccesor-usage]
max-threads=2)
RC5-72: Completed CA:795C96AA:00000000 (1.00 stats units) 0.00:20:02.04 - [3,390,487 keys/s]
RC5-72: Completed CA:795C96A9:00000000 (1.00 stats units) 0.00:19:36.01 - [3,388,344 keys/s]
что уже ближе к делу. Потоки пошли по одному в процессор и теперь блок вычислений процессора не шарится, а он один для двух логич. процов при НТ.
У Argentum'а наверное 2 физических проца, а еще два- логические от НТ.
|
| |
Да, действительно помогло, спасибо.
25.01.04 08:35
Автор: Argentum[BugTraq.ru] Статус: Незарегистрированный пользователь
|
> После установки numcpu = 2 > (в dnetc.ini запись > [proccesor-usage] > max-threads=2)
Да, действительно помогло, спасибо.
Сервак действительно не мой, просто я знаю к нему пароль ;)
Буду пускать иногда по ночам, когда дежурю...
|
| |
И как это установить? Я пробовал в конфиг клиента эту... 22.01.04 20:17
Автор: Argentum[BugTraq.ru] Статус: Незарегистрированный пользователь
|
> Конфигурация 2*Xeon -2.4/533/512 HT enable
> при дефолтных настройках > 4 crunchers ('a'-'d') have been started.
> После установки numcpu = 2
И как это установить? Я пробовал в конфиг клиента эту строчку прописать (причем в разных местах) - эффекту ноль, так же 4 потока лезут.
|
| | |
А описание в лом почитать? Или в конфиг клиента залезть...
23.01.04 01:35
Автор: mss <Сергей> Статус: Member
|
> И как это установить? Я пробовал в конфиг клиента эту > строчку прописать (причем в разных местах) - эффекту ноль, > так же 4 потока лезут.
А описание в лом почитать? Или в конфиг клиента залезть...
[processor-usage]
max-threads=2
|
| | | |
ну mss... спрашивающий товарищ начинающий, имеет право на ошибки. а вот Garick мог бы (не обязан конечно) сразу корректно написать кусок конфига. или он 10 байт экономит в форуме? :))) 23.01.04 10:01
Автор: jammer <alex naumov> Статус: Elderman
|
|
| | | | |
Сорри...
23.01.04 15:54
Автор: mss <Сергей> Статус: Member
|
Сорри...
Вообще-то я полагал, что эта опция описана в сопутствующих клиенту доках.
Слишком давно я их читал. А так - RTFM тут явно не уместен.
Но меня оправдывает то, что я не сказал ответ только из четырёх букв: RTFM
(что новичку было бы непонятно, а когда бы стало понятно - то и обидно)
Всё-таки я привёл правильные строчки конфига, так что вот... :-Р
|
| | | | |
спрашивающий товарищ начинающий [off] 23.01.04 10:48
Автор: Garick <Yuriy> Статус: Elderman
|
>спрашивающий товарищ начинающий
Когда постил ответ, не знал о том что Аргентум не админ. "Проблемная" конфигурация склоняла к мысли о том что это сервер и Аргентум -админ и знает ЧТО, ЗАЧЕМ и КАК_НАСТРОИТЬ, установленное на сервере.:-))))
|
| | | |
А описание в лом почитать? Или в конфиг клиента залезть... 23.01.04 05:59
Автор: Argentum[BugTraq.ru] Статус: Незарегистрированный пользователь
|
> > И как это установить? Я пробовал в конфиг клиента эту > > строчку прописать (причем в разных местах) - эффекту > ноль, > > так же 4 потока лезут. > > А описание в лом почитать? Или в конфиг клиента залезть... > > [processor-usage] > max-threads=2
Спасибо. А где вы их берете?
У меня в скачанном клиенте были вложены текстовики и html-ка, но там не было подробного описания всех доступных опций и в ini-файле, идущем там, опций - по минимуму, остальные, видимо, по дефолту, но где их перечень с описанием?
Вот в комплекте к препроксе все это есть, я с удовольствием изучил и настроил все как надо. Сложно было и в клиента вложить?
|
| | | | |
Хммм.... а ведь и правда нету...
23.01.04 06:45
Автор: mss <Сергей> Статус: Member
|
> Вот в комплекте к препроксе все это есть, я с удовольствием > изучил и настроил все как надо. Сложно было и в клиента > вложить?
Хммм.... а ведь и правда нету...
Ну я-то делал просто, а главное на автомате:
dnetc -config
3) Performance related options
2) Number of crunchers to run simultaneously ==> 2
...
дальше лезу в dnetc.ini
а там те самые две строчки
кут/пасте в форум :)
|
| | | | | |
Хммм.... а ведь и правда нету... 25.01.04 08:32
Автор: Argentum[BugTraq.ru] Статус: Незарегистрированный пользователь
|
> > Вот в комплекте к препроксе все это есть, я с > удовольствием > > изучил и настроил все как надо. Сложно было и в > клиента > > вложить? > > Хммм.... а ведь и правда нету... > Ну я-то делал просто, а главное на автомате: > dnetc -config > 3) Performance related options > 2) Number of crunchers to run simultaneously ==> 2 > ... > дальше лезу в dnetc.ini
Здорово, я-то сначала именно так настраивал, когда первый раз клиента запустил (там вообще конфига не было), настроил необходимый минимум, потом по интернету поглядел, у кого еще каке конфиги есть, ручками подправил как надо. А про первый способ и забыл. Ну все равно лучшеб они в архив к клиенту вкладывали описание всех возможных параметров конфига.
|
|
Попробуй отключи HT! 19.01.04 10:17
Автор: Yurii <Юрий> Статус: Elderman Отредактировано 19.01.04 10:18 Количество правок: 1
|
|
| |
В кзеонах, слава богу, пока нет НТ! 19.01.04 15:17
Автор: Garick <Yuriy> Статус: Elderman
|
|
| | |
Кто такое сказал? 19.01.04 15:50
Автор: JINN <Sergey> Статус: Elderman
|
Intel® Xeon™ Processor
Available speeds : 1MB cache: 3.20 GHz, 3.06 GHz / 512KB cache: 3.06 GHz, 2.80GHz, 2.66GHz, 2.40GHz, 2GHz
Features : Hyper-Threading Technology
http://www.intel.com/products/server/processors/server/xeon/index.htm
Intel® Xeon™ Processor MP
Available speeds: 2.80 GHz, 2.50 GHz, 2 GHz, 1.90 GHz, 1.60 GHz, 1.50 GHz, 1.40 GHz
Cache: Level 1: Execution Trace cache /Level 2: 512KB or 256KB Advanced Transfer cache/Level 3: 2MB, 1MB or 512KB
Features : Hyper-Threading technology
http://www.intel.com/products/server/processors/server/xeon_mp/index.htm?iid=ipp_srvr_proc_xeon+xeon_mp&
|
| | | |
Пардон, ошибся, старый роадмап 19.01.04 16:19
Автор: Garick <Yuriy> Статус: Elderman
|
Ни когда не пробывал быков на HT, но скоро в экспериментальных целях попробую.
Но судя из логов - 4 проца определились быками и 4 физических, значит HT - выключен. Или может система работает на 2-х физ и 2-х логич, поэтому и производительность теряется. Логический в HT менее производительный, чем физический .
|
| | | | |
Нет, дело в ОС-ке. 19.01.04 16:32
Автор: JINN <Sergey> Статус: Elderman
|
> Но судя из логов - 4 проца определились быками и 4 > физических, значит HT - выключен. Или может система > работает на 2-х физ и 2-х логич, поэтому и > производительность теряется. Логический в HT менее > производительный, чем физический . Технология HT поддерживается только начиная с XP.
http://www.intel.com/support/platform/ht/os.htm?iid=ipp_htm+os&
в2к "видит" честные 4 проца. А должна бы "видеть" 8.
|
| | | | | |
WIN2K (NT5.0) работает в режиме совместимости с НТ. Но ХР... 19.01.04 17:11
Автор: Garick <Yuriy> Статус: Elderman Отредактировано 19.01.04 18:34 Количество правок: 1
|
> Технология HT поддерживается только начиная с XP. > http://www.intel.com/support/platform/ht/os.htm?iid=ipp_htm > +os&
WIN2K (NT5.0) работает в режиме совместимости с НТ. Но ХР (NT 5.1) уже нормально "заточена" под НТ.
И алгоритм разгреба из БИОСА подключенных процов (физ и лог) в ХР "правильный". В представительстве Intel "настойчиво рекомендуют" для НТ юзать XP или WinSrv2003 (NT 5.2).
> в2к "видит" честные 4 проца. А должна бы "видеть" 8. Может включен НТ и WIN 2K ADv SRV неправильно выгреб конфигурацию процессоров. Надо больше информации.
Включен ли НТ?
|
| | | | | | |
[RC5] ощущение что физических всего два... эх, жаль такую машину терять, хоть и интел, но все же, хотя бы не выключается 22.01.04 17:51
Автор: jammer <alex naumov> Статус: Elderman
|
|
| | | | | | |
[RC5] WIN2K (NT5.0) работает в режиме совместимости с НТ. Но ХР... 21.01.04 13:00
Автор: Argentum[BugTraq.ru] Статус: Незарегистрированный пользователь
|
> Может включен НТ и WIN 2K ADv SRV неправильно выгреб > конфигурацию процессоров. Надо больше информации. > Включен ли НТ?
Наверно нет...
Но уже все равно - заметил админ и дал по башке. Пришлось снять с этого сервака.
|
|
|